Potential Interactions Between Cbd And Zoloft

CBD may alter how Zoloft works in your body. Zoloft, a medication for depression, needs attention if combined with CBD. The cytochrome P450 enzyme system plays a key role here. This system breaks down many drugs, including Zoloft. Consuming CBD can change how these enzymes work. It might slow down the breakdown of Zoloft. This could increase Zoloft levels in the blood, potentially leading to side effects. Therefore, talking to a doctor before mixing CBD with Zoloft is crucial.

What Research Says

Research on the interaction between CBD and SSRIs like Zoloft is limited. Experts are exploring how CBD might affect serotonin levels in the brain. Some studies suggest potential benefits in using CBD with SSRis. Yet, the scientific evidence is not conclusive.

The existing data is often based on small sample sizes or animal studies. Human trials are necessary to understand the effects more clearly.
